With the government shutdown starting today and the uncertainty of how long the shutdown will continue, Customs and Border Protection (CBP) has advised that the shutdown may impact the processing of bonds and riders.  Yesterday, CBP issued the following statement.

“FEDERAL GOVERNMENT SHUTDOWN

Due to the Federal Government shutdown, the Revenue Division Bond Team is operating with a limited staff.  As a result, we will not be able to maintain our standards of processing submissions within five (5) full business days.  The Bond Team will focus on processing, as a result, we will not be able to return phone calls and/or answer status questions in a timely manner.  We suggest that you consult ABI and/or ACE for additional information regarding your submission.

We apologize for the inconvenience.”

Fortunately, due to our electronic link with Customs database, and access to the various Customs systems noted above, we do not expect any delay in notifying your office when a bond has been processed, though we cannot predict how this situation may affect how quickly Customs processes bonds and riders.
